How much power does Manny Pacquiao have left?
Pacquiao’s last TKO was in November of 2009 against Miguel Cotto. Since that time Pacquiao has knocked people down but never has shown the type of knockout power that had has lesser weights. Mayweather has been in the ring with some pretty hard punchers as of late (Maidana, Cotto, Canelo & Guerrero) and has shown a pretty sturdy chin. Pacquiao still believes he can hurt Mayweather according to Boxing News 24.
“If I hurt him [Mayweather]. I expect him to run. Otherwise he might fight me toe-to-toe,” Pacquiao said.
Boxing News 24 points out (and this is how you can tell they do indeed watch boxing 24/7) that Mayweather when hurt tends to hold, not run. His general plan when he feels he is in danger is to tie his opponent up and get out of danger.
Mayweather will be the bigger man in the ring, so while he will use movement I don’t think you will see him move as much when fighting Pacquiao. It will be more subtle movements to get in a position to counter more than anything else.
